Overview
Prof. Dr. Venkat Ramakrishnan is an internationally renowned Plastic and Breast Reconstructive Surgeon with over four decades of distinguished experience. He is internationally recognised for his work in breast reconstruction, particularly using DIEP (Deep Inferior Epigastric Perforator) and TUG (Transverse Upper Gracilis) flaps. To date, he has performed over 1,500 microsurgical reconstructions with outstanding clinical outcomes. His experience in cosmetic plastic surgery dates back to 1987.
His subspecialties include reconstructive and cosmetic breast surgery, aesthetic facial surgery, lipo-sculpting, and body contouring procedures. He has a special focus on aesthetic and reconstructive surgery of the breast, and microsurgical reconstruction forms a significant part of his NHS practice as Consultant Plastic Surgeon at a leading hospital in Essex, UK.
Prof. Ramakrishnan is actively involved in academic and professional leadership. He has also published over 100 peer-reviewed articles and has delivered numerous keynote addresses and presentations at major international conferences.
